METHOD OF LOCAL APPLICATION OF METAL COATINGS AT SAMPLES OF THERMOELECTRIC MATERIALS BY ELECTROLYTIC METHOD Russian patent published in 2011 - IPC C25D5/02 

Abstract RU 2412285 C1

FIELD: instrument making.

SUBSTANCE: method is characterised by using DC source, electrolysis math with window in wall covered with elastic insert for tight fixation of covered samples, cover with anode and cathode, such as each sample, at sides or faces of which coating is applied. Each sample is placed into through slot congruent with its shape arranged in elastic insert, which tightly covers bath window from outside and is fixed with application of frame that tightly presses insert to bath wall. Bath is filled with electrolyte, anode is submerged, and electric current is supplied using current conductors arranged in inserts and contacting with samples, until specified parametres of coating are obtained.

EFFECT: making it possible to simultaneously apply local coating at samples of various shape with area of coverage from 0,5 mm2, excluding additional current losses and exhaustion of electrolyte.
